Quality notes
- Designed for consistent clearance and long service life when installed with proper lubrication.
- Replace pins and bushings as a set when wear is uneven to prevent premature failure.
Installation tip
Measure the bore, pin, and bushing after press-fit. Use proper tooling and lubrication, and re-check end-play after assembly.

Komatsu maintenance notes (quick guide)
- Early-life greasing: For excavators, Komatsu guidance calls for greasing work equipment pins every 10 hours for the first 50 hours, and greasing again after water work.
- Clearance control: Komatsu linkage manuals commonly specify pinbushing clearance targets and a typical service limit around 1.0 mm for many joints, often managed with shims.
- Tracked machines: For undercarriage track joints, pin/bushing turning is condition- and wear-window dependent; abrasive sites can accelerate wear substantially.
